2026 Supreme(Cal) 477

IN THE HIGH COURT AT CALCUTTA
SABYASACHI BHATTACHARYYA, SUPRATIM BHATTACHARYA
Soma Mandal Debnath – Appellant
Versus
Tanmoy Debnath – Respondent


Advocates Appeared:
For the Appellant : Mr. Pappu Adhikary, Mr. Somnath Banerjee, Mr. Pradip Pal
For the Respondent: Mr. Ayan Mitra, Ms. Moumita Dhar

JUDGMENT :

Sabyasachi Bhattacharyya, J.

1. The present appeal has been preferred by the plaintiff/appellant-wife against a judgment and decree whereby the learned Trial Judge dismissed the plaintiff's suit for divorce.

2. The marriage between the parties took place on June 18, 2007 under the Special Marriage Act, 1954 (hereinafter referred to as “the 1954 Act”). Upon such marriage, the appellant/wife moved to her matrimonial home at Sankrail, Howrah and started residing there. The appellant, upon completion of her MBBS Course, joined nursing homes in and around Kolkata as medical attendant in the year 2008, after completion of her housestaffship.

3. In 2009, the appellant, then a practising doctor, joined the Manickchak Hospital at Malda as a Medical Officer and became permanent in the year 2010 at the Malda Bamungola Rural Hospital. Later on, in the year 2011, the appellant joined the West Bengal Health Services at Margram Public Health Centre in the District of Birbhum. However, she applied and got a posting at the Public Health Centre, Hazi St. Mollah, BPHC, Sankrail and resided in her matrimonial home.
